The cheapest way to get from Cape Cod to Southold is to drive and car ferry which costs $35 - $130 and takes 4h 17m.
The fastest way to get from Cape Cod to Southold is to drive and car ferry which takes 4h 17m and costs $35 - $130.
No, there is no direct bus from Cape Cod to Southold. However, there are services departing from Town Hall Lawton Bus Shelter and arriving at Southold via Hyannis Transportation Center, Boston, West 42nd Street & 8th Avenue and 41st St bet 3rd & Lex.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 12h.
The distance between Cape Cod and Southold is 215 miles.
The best way to get from Cape Cod to Southold without a car is to bus and train and car ferry which takes 8h 45m and costs $70 - $210.
It takes approximately 8h 45m to get from Cape Cod to Southold, including transfers.
Cape Cod to Southold bus services, operated by Plymouth & Brockton, depart from Hyannis Transportation Center station.
Cape Cod to Southold bus services, operated by Plymouth & Brockton, arrive at Boston South Buses station.
